Picture of the oldest market in our village. This market is a witness of many history. This market may have started long before the British rule. This market is held once a week on Sunday. This haat is the center of people's livelihood, so a lot of people gather in this haat. So many people used to gather that the noise of people could be heard for three to four kilometers in the bazaar. So there is a myth about this market. Angels descend from the sky when this market is established. As everything is modern, people don't gather in this market like before.
